01 / ARCHITECTURE: The Mild Drive Philosophy
Every E-XDV variant is built around the Mild Drive motor architecture — a mid-mounted powertrain that replaces the chain with a synchronous belt drive rated for 50,000 km without replacement. The standard model starts at 6000W with a 15 KW peak. The Pro pushes to 19 KW. The Pro Max climbs to 29 KW with water-cooling, reaching motor efficiency of up to 93% and an IP67 waterproof rating. 02 / BATTERYRange That Changes the ConversationThe E-XDV Pro Max carries a removable solid-state battery at 275V and 60Ah — delivering a tested range of 230 km at a steady 50 km/h. Even at 100 km/h sustained cruising, the Pro Max covers 120 km on a single charge. The dual-battery parallel technology uses a dedicated BMS that continuously identifies and adjusts differential pressure between cells, ensuring consistent performance over 15,000 charge cycles. 03 / CHARGINGThree Charging PathsHECHHI designed three distinct charging solutions. At a standard car charging station with CCS2 compatibility, the E-XDV Pro Max reaches full charge in under 30 minutes. With the motorcycle-customized charging pile — available in 12+12 KW or 6.7+6.7 KW configurations — a full charge takes just 20 minutes. And because every HECHHI battery is removable, riders can carry it home and charge from a standard 220V wall outlet in 2 to 4 hours. The E-XDV meets you wherever power exists.

The 1800 x 580 x 1250 mm footprint is compact enough for dense urban parking, while the 1360 mm wheelbase delivers a tight turning circle for U-turns on narrow streets. The 780 mm seat height accommodates a wide range of riders, and the 180 mm ground clearance — matching the Bigboy 100 Naked — means speed bumps and kerb cuts are handled without hesitation. Both variants share identical dimensions and weight, meaning the Pro’s extra performance comes from smarter engineering, not heavier materials.
The standard SpeedX carries a 2000W one-side hub motor that delivers 45 km/h or 55 km/h depending on configuration — making it compliant with L1e-class regulations across European markets. With one battery at 60V 24Ah, it covers 50 km at 35 km/h; with two batteries, that doubles to 100 km. The SpeedX Pro swaps in a 6000W one-side hub motor, pushing top speed to 95 km/h and range to 130 km at 45 km/h on its dual 72V 30Ah Samsung 21700 cell packs. Same scooter. Two entirely different riding experiences.
The SpeedX Pro uses Samsung 21700 cylindrical cells — the same cell format used by Tesla in its latest battery packs. These cells offer a superior energy density-to-weight ratio compared to the standard model’s lithium cylindrical cells, allowing the Pro to carry 2 x 72V 30Ah without adding a single kilogram to the chassis. Charging is via an 84V 10A charger with a full charge in 6.5 hours — overnight-ready. The standard model charges at 72V 5A in 5.5 hours. Both use removable battery packs, meaning riders without garage access can carry their power source indoors.
The SpeedX Pro introduces a feature unique in the HECHHI lineup at this price point: a mirror-mounted head radar system with steering integration. This system scans the rider’s blind spots and alerts through the mirror display — a technology typically reserved for premium touring motorcycles. Combined with the Pro’s dual-channel ABS on both disc brakes and hydraulic gas damping suspension, the result is a scooter that actively protects its rider in dense traffic. The standard SpeedX uses hydraulic damping and disc brakes without ABS — a capable setup for city speeds, but the Pro is built for riders who push further and faster.

01 / DRIVETRAIN
The One-Side Hub Motor
Where most electric motorcycles hide their drivetrain in the frame, the Bigboy mounts a 6000W one-side hub motor directly into the rear wheel. Rated at 6 kW with a 10 kW peak, this arrangement eliminates the chain, the belt, and the drivetrain loss that comes with them. Power transfers from motor to tarmac with zero intermediaries — reaching 8000 rpm peak motor speed with 93% motor efficiency.
02 / BATTERY
Dual Battery, No CompromiseThe Bigboy 100 Naked runs on removable ATL LFP batteries — the same cell chemistry trusted in grid-scale energy storage. The standard model pairs two batteries at 74V and 28Ah for 110 km of range at 55 km/h. The Max variant upgrades to 75V and 60Ah, extending range to 230 km. The BMS automatically identifies and adjusts differential pressure between the two battery groups, ensuring consistent performance and longer cycle life
.03 / CHARGING
Three Ways to ChargeThe standard Bigboy charges in 6 hours via the 84V 10A external charger. The Max variant is equipped with an 84V 45A on-board charger (OBC) completing the full 60Ah pack in 2.5 hours. Both models are compatible with HECHHI's CCS2 fast-charging: at a car charging station, the Max reaches full charge in under 30 minutes. Portable batteries charge from any standard 220V wall outlet.

The E-Cargo carries a removable lithium battery at 72V and 50Ah — the largest single-pack capacity in the HECHHI range. A single battery delivers 110 km of range. With a second pack installed, that extends to 220 km — enough to cover an entire day of multi-stop delivery routes without returning to base. The battery is removable, meaning fleet operators can deploy swap stations along a route: ride out on one battery, swap at a checkpoint, ride back on another. No charging downtime. No range anxiety. No compromises.
Unlike other HECHHI models that rely on external chargers, the E-Cargo integrates a 72V 25A on-board charger (OBC) with a dedicated charging gun. This means the charger travels with the motorcycle — no separate equipment to carry, no cables to forget. Plug the charging gun into a compatible station or a standard outlet, and the full battery reaches 100% in 4.5 hours. For fleet operators running overnight depot charging, this means every E-Cargo returns in the evening and departs at dawn — fully charged, no external chargers required. An optional external 72V 25A charger with two plugs is also available for depot-level simultaneous charging.
At 2090 mm long and 710 mm wide, the E-Cargo has the longest chassis in the HECHHI motorcycle lineup. This is not excess — this is purpose. The extended wheelbase of 1430 mm provides stability under heavy loads, while the 800 mm seat height keeps the rider comfortable during long shifts. The 5000W hub motor delivers consistent torque through stop-start delivery cycles, reaching 100 km/h when the route demands highway sections. A windshield comes standard, reducing rider fatigue at speed, and the optional big delivery box transforms the rear into a purpose-built cargo platform.
Where many cargo motorcycles offer ABS as an optional extra, the E-Cargo includes front and rear disc brakes with ABS as standard equipment. This is a deliberate engineering decision. A loaded cargo motorcycle has a higher centre of gravity and longer stopping distances than an unladen commuter — the margin for error is smaller, and the consequences of a lock-up are greater. The 110/70-16 front tyre and 120/70-14 rear tyre on aluminum alloy rims provide the contact patch needed to manage braking forces under load, while the CST vacuum tyres resist punctures from the road debris that cargo riders encounter daily.
